{ "verseID": "Numbers.7.1", "source": "וַיְהִ֡י בְּיוֹם֩ כַּלּ֨וֹת מֹשֶׁ֜ה לְהָקִ֣ים אֶת־הַמִּשְׁכָּ֗ן וַיִּמְשַׁ֨ח אֹת֜וֹ וַיְקַדֵּ֤שׁ אֹתוֹ֙ וְאֶת־כָּל־כֵּלָ֔יו וְאֶת־הַמִּזְבֵּ֖חַ וְאֶת־כָּל־כֵּלָ֑יו וַיִּמְשָׁחֵ֖ם וַיְקַדֵּ֥שׁ אֹתָֽם׃", "text": "*wa-yəhî* in *yôm* *kallôt* *Mōšeh* *ləhāqîm* *ʾet*-the-*miškān* *wa-yimšaḥ* *ʾōtô* *wa-yəqaddēš* *ʾōtô* *wə-ʾet*-all-*kēlāyw* *wə-ʾet*-the-*mizbēaḥ* *wə-ʾet*-all-*kēlāyw* *wa-yimšāḥēm* *wa-yəqaddēš* *ʾōtām*", "grammar": { "*wa-yəhî*": "consecutive imperfect, 3rd masculine singular - and it came to pass/happened", "*yôm*": "masculine singular construct - day of", "*kallôt*": "infinitive construct of *kālâ* - to complete/finish", "*Mōšeh*": "proper noun, masculine singular - Moses", "*ləhāqîm*": "preposition + hiphil infinitive construct - to set up/erect", "*ʾet*": "direct object marker", "*miškān*": "noun, masculine singular - tabernacle/dwelling place", "*wa-yimšaḥ*": "consecutive imperfect, 3rd masculine singular - and he anointed", "*ʾōtô*": "direct object marker with 3rd masculine singular suffix - it/him", "*wa-yəqaddēš*": "consecutive imperfect, 3rd masculine singular, piel - and he sanctified/consecrated", "*kēlāyw*": "noun, masculine plural construct with 3rd masculine singular suffix - his vessels/utensils", "*mizbēaḥ*": "noun, masculine singular - altar", "*wa-yimšāḥēm*": "consecutive imperfect, 3rd masculine singular with 3rd masculine plural suffix - and he anointed them", "*wa-yəqaddēš*": "consecutive imperfect, 3rd masculine singular, piel - and he sanctified/consecrated", "*ʾōtām*": "direct object marker with 3rd masculine plural suffix - them" }, "variants": { "*yəhî*": "happened/came to pass/was", "*kallôt*": "finishing/completing/ending", "*ləhāqîm*": "to raise up/to erect/to establish", "*miškān*": "tabernacle/dwelling place/tent sanctuary", "*yimšaḥ*": "anointed/smeared with oil", "*yəqaddēš*": "sanctified/consecrated/set apart" } }
